A DNA (deoxyribonucleic acid) test will be conducted at the Kuala Lumpur Hospital tomorrow morning on the body found in a concrete-filled drum, said Datuk Richard Morais.

Richard, the younger brother of Attorney General's Chambers Appellate and Trial Division deputy head Anthony Kevin Morais, said the test would be carried out to help identify the remains.

"Although police have confirmed the body as my brother's, the process of verification will still be conducted by taking a DNA sample from a family member," said Richard, a businessman, when contacted by Bernama today.

Kevin Morais' body was found in the concrete-filled drum in Subang Jaya near here yesterday after one of the seven suspects brought police to the location in a housing area in USJ 1 at Persiaran Subang Mewah.

Kevin Morais, 55, was reported missing on Sept 4 after last seen leaving his apartment at Menara Duta, Kuala Lumpur for his office in Putrajaya in a Proton Perdana with registration number WA6264Q.
